The Complete Mornington Peninsula Septic Maintenance Checklist

Septic Tank Maintenance Checklist Tasks Organised By Frequency

Maintaining a septic tank effectively follows a frequency-based schedule, not a reactive one.

The full maintenance checklist organised by task frequency is:

Ongoing (daily and weekly household habits):

  1. Avoid flushing non-biodegradable items including wet wipes, sanitary products, and paper towel.
  2. Avoid pouring fats, oils, grease, or coffee grounds down any drain.
  3. Avoid using antibacterial cleaning products, bleach, or chemical drain cleaners in quantities that reach the tank.
  4. Spread laundry loads across the week rather than doing multiple loads in a single day.
  5. Monitor household water use and address any dripping taps, leaking toilets, or unusual usage increases promptly.

Annually:

  1.  Inspect access lids for cracks, sinkage, or any sign of water infiltration.
  2. Check the ground above and immediately around the tank for any settlement or surface movement.
  3. Walk the absorption field area and check for wet patches, unusually green grass, or ponding water.
  4. Note any odour changes, particularly persistent sewage smell either inside or outside the property.
  5.  Record the date of the last professional pump-out and confirm whether the next is due.

Every Three to Five Years:

  1. Engage a licensed plumber to professionally pump out the tank and remove accumulated sludge and scum.
  2. Have the plumber inspect the inlet and outlet baffles for condition and correct positioning.
  3. Have the sludge depth assessed relative to the tank’s total capacity before the pump-out confirms the appropriate interval for the next service.
  4. Have the absorption field assessed for any signs of overloading, clogging, or reduced capacity.

After Heavy Rainfall:

  1. Check the absorption field area for surface ponding within 24 to 48 hours of heavy rain.
  2. Monitor indoor drains for slow movement or unusual gurgling that was not present before the rainfall.
  3. Check access lids for evidence of surface water infiltration into the tank chamber.

What Should Never Go Into a Septic System?

Items And Chemicals That Should Never Go Into A Septic Tank System

The biological process that keeps a septic system functioning depends on a stable colony of anaerobic bacteria inside the tank, and septic tank care starts with protecting that colony from the household side.

The items and substances that most consistently damage septic systems on the Mornington Peninsula are:

  • Wet wipes and sanitary products: These do not break down inside the tank and accumulate rapidly, blocking outlet baffles and shortening the interval before pump-out is needed.
  • Chemical drain cleaners: These kill anaerobic bacteria directly and can damage the concrete or polyethylene structure of the tank itself.
  • Bleach and antibacterial products in volume: Small amounts used normally in household cleaning do not cause significant harm, but regular heavy use of disinfectants suppresses the bacterial colony and reduces the system’s digestion capacity.
  • Cooking fats and oils: These float to the top of the scum layer, accumulate faster than bacteria can break them down, and are a leading cause of outlet baffle blockage.
  • Medications including antibiotics: These pass through the household waste stream and affect bacterial activity over time.

Maintaining a septic system well means treating the tank’s biological environment as something that can be helped or harmed by what is put into it.

The Annual Inspection: What a Homeowner Can Check?

Annual Septic Tank Inspection Checking Access Lid Condition On The Mornington Peninsula

The annual check that a homeowner can complete without professional assistance is a visual and sensory inspection of the areas around the system, not of the system’s internal components.

The components inside the tank, including the baffles, partition wall, and sludge layers, are assessed by a licensed plumber during a professional pump-out. A detailed breakdown of what the internal components of a septic tank look like and what each one does gives useful context for understanding what the plumber is looking for during an inspection.

The annual checks a homeowner can complete safely are:

  • Access lid condition: Lids that are cracked, sunken, or sitting unevenly above the tank allow surface water to enter and can pose a safety hazard if the structural integrity has been compromised.
  • Ground settlement above the tank: Any depression or uneven ground directly over the tank can indicate movement in the tank structure or deterioration of the surrounding soil.
  • The absorption field: A monthly walk of the absorption area is sufficient for most properties. In summer, an unusually green strip of grass above the absorption trench can indicate effluent surfacing. In any season, ponding water above the absorption area is a clear sign the field is under stress.
  • Odour: A low-level smell during wind changes near the tank is normal. A persistent strong sewage odour at ground level or inside the property is not.

The Three to Five Year Professional Pump-Out

Professional Septic Tank Pump-Out At A Mornington Peninsula Residential Property

A professional pump-out is the core maintenance task for any septic system and should not be deferred based on the system appearing to function normally.

The sludge layer builds incrementally and gives no external warning until it reaches the outlet baffle level, at which point solid material begins entering the absorption field, causing damage that is expensive and in some cases impossible to fully reverse.

The pump-out process conducted by a licensed plumber involves:

  1. Locating and opening the access lids on both chambers of the tank.
  2. Measuring the sludge depth before pumping to assess how quickly the tank has filled relative to the previous service interval.
  3. Pumping out the full contents of the tank using a vacuum tanker, removing accumulated sludge, scum, and effluent.
  4. Inspecting the internal components including the inlet and outlet baffles, the partition wall, and the tank walls and base for cracking, root intrusion, or baffle deterioration.
  5. Assessing the absorption field outlet for signs of solid carry-over from the tank that may indicate the tank was overdue for pump-out.
  6. Recommending the next service interval based on the sludge accumulation rate observed during this visit.

The tank should never be entered by anyone at any point in this process. Septic tanks are classified as confined spaces under Safe Work Australia’s confined space hazard guidelines, and the hydrogen sulphide gas produced by anaerobic digestion can cause rapid loss of consciousness and death with minimal exposure in an enclosed environment.

All inspection work is conducted by the licensed plumber from above the access opening using appropriate inspection tools.

After Heavy Rain on the Mornington Peninsula

Heavy rainfall is the event that most commonly reveals a septic system that is underperforming, because saturated soil loses its ability to absorb effluent and forces the system into a state of temporary overload.

The sandy coastal soils common across much of the lower Peninsula drain relatively quickly compared to clay soils, but during heavy rainfall events the absorption capacity of even well-draining soils is temporarily reduced.

The two to three days after significant rainfall are the most reliable time to observe whether a system is coping with its normal load or showing signs of reduced capacity.

Surface ponding that appears over the absorption field in the days following heavy rain, particularly if it was not present after similar rainfall previously, is an early indicator that the absorption field capacity is reducing and a professional assessment is warranted.

Signs That Need Same-Day Attention

 Signs Of Septic System Failure Including Surface Ponding At A Mornington Peninsula Property

Some signs indicate a system that has moved beyond maintenance territory and requires immediate professional intervention.

As Better Health Channel’s guidance on sewage overflows confirms, a sewage disposal system that is not properly maintained cannot safely manage wastewater, and a system that is actively failing creates health risks that extend beyond the property.

The signs that require same-day contact with a licensed plumber are:

  • Sewage backing up through floor wastes, toilets, or showers inside the property.
  • Persistent sewage odour inside the property that does not resolve with ventilation.
  • Visible sewage at the surface above the absorption field or anywhere on the property.
  • All drains in the property draining slowly simultaneously, which points to the main drain or the tank rather than a localised blockage.
  • Gurgling sounds from multiple fixtures when the system is not in active use.

Septic tank upkeep that is allowed to lapse to the point where any of these signs appear has moved from a maintenance issue to a remediation issue, and the cost of addressing it at that stage is significantly higher than the cost of the scheduled maintenance that would have prevented it.

When Maintaining the System Is No Longer the Right Answer?

For properties where the septic system is at or past the end of its design life, where the absorption field has failed and cannot be rehabilitated, or where the pump-out frequency is increasing rapidly, continuing to maintain the system may not be the most cost-effective long-term approach.

The benefits of connecting from septic to mains sewer include the permanent removal of pump-out costs, maintenance obligations, and environmental compliance risk, and for many Peninsula homeowners the upgrade makes better financial sense than continued investment in an ageing system.

Where sewer infrastructure has reached or is accessible from the property boundary, a licensed plumber can assess the connection feasibility and cost before any decision is made.
